Wiz Khalifa to Headline 2017 Bunbury Music Festival

Wiz Khalifa is starting to load up his summer festival schedule, as he has recently been announced as a headliner for the 2017 Bunbury Music Festival. He’ll be joining a few EDM artists, another hip-hip artist and a rock band as headliners for this one. That other hip-hop artist is G-Eazy. As for the other headliners, they are Pretty Lights, Bassnectar and Muse.

This is Wiz’s second confirmed headlining show, as he’ll be performing at Bunbury as well as Camp Mars August 12-14. The 2017 Bunbury Music Festival is set to run June 2-4 in Cincinnati, Ohio.
